Success for School of Law in the Complete University Guide 2023 Subject League Table

The Complete University Guide has ranked the University of Leeds 7th in the UK for Law in its 2023 subject league table.

The Complete University Guide league tables are a key resource for prospective students, ranking the best universities in the UK, overall and in 74 subject areas. All the data comes from sources in the public domain and includes the results of the National Student Survey and the 2021 Research Excellence Framework (REF).

The Subject League Table for Law ranks 106 institutions and is based on five measures: entry standards, student satisfaction, research quality, research intensity and graduate prospects. The School of Law has ranked 7th in the UK for 2023, up five places from 12th in last year’s table.
